Should You Just Wait to List Your Home? Insights for North County Buyers

Aerial view of North County San Diego real estate market, luxury coastal homes.

Understanding the Current Real Estate Landscape

As we navigate the complex dynamics of the real estate market in 2025, many sellers remain hopeful for a resurgence in buyer interest, despite growing concerns from industry experts. Jim Klinge, a seasoned realtor, cautions sellers that the long-held belief in a booming market might be misleading. With a significant shift in buyer behavior, akin to the evolution seen in tech markets, sellers must examine whether holding onto their properties could lead to missed opportunities.

Why Patience May Not Be a Virtue

In a housing market characterized by fluctuating prices and economic uncertainties, Jim's perspective highlights a crucial question: what happens when buyers stop coming? The fear that the market may have peaked poses a significant risk, especially for those who have grown accustomed to continuous sales. Just as the tech industry has seen its ups and downs, the real estate market might be on the verge of a downturn.

The Age-Old Dilemma: To Sell or to Wait?

For homeowners caught between the desire to sell high and the dread of lower offers, patience may lead to problems down the road. With baby boomers aging, the potential for a gradual decline in housing prices looms. Sellers need to weigh the inconvenience of a waiting game against the risk of price stabilization or a potential drop. This is particularly evident in high-demand areas like Carlsbad, where the allure of $2 million homes might start to fade.

Practical Tips for Sellers

  • Conduct Thorough Market Research: Keep a pulse on community trends and stay updated on local market conditions.
  • Evaluate Home Pricing: Consult with professionals to get an accurate assessment of market value and realistic pricing strategies.
  • Consider Timing: Analyze the best times to list your home based on trends and economic projections.
  • Flexibility is Key: Be willing to adjust expectations and strategies as the market evolves.

Transform Your Moving Experience with These Essential Tips

Update Mastering the Art of Moving: Essential Tips Moving can be a daunting task, but with the right strategies, it doesn't have to be a chaotic experience. For residents of North County San Diego, where homes come in various shapes and sizes, adopting a practical and systematic approach can ensure that moving day goes smoothly. From efficient packing to decluttering, here are key insights to make your move as seamless as possible. Simplify Packing with Efficiency When the moving process begins, one of the biggest challenges is packing efficiently. For a hassle-free experience, consider these expert packing tips: Keep Clothing on Hangers: Instead of folding clothes, keep them on hangers and cover them with large garbage bags. This method allows you to move clothes straight from the closet to your new home without extra hassle. Utilize Luggage for Heavy Items: Rather than using empty suitcases, fill them with heavy belongings like books. This approach not only saves boxes but also makes transporting heavy items much easier. Leverage Available Resources: Use clothing, towels, or linens as protective materials to wrap fragile items instead of purchasing bubble wrap. This strategy saves space and reduces costs, making your move more economical. The Power of Decluttering One of the most effective ways to simplify your move involves adopting a decluttering mindset. Before you begin packing, take stock of what you truly need to take with you. Here are some actionable steps to declutter: Assess your belongings and identify items you can donate, sell, or discard. Consider letting go of items you haven’t used in the past year. Remember, it’s okay to start anew. Dispose of belongings that won’t fit in your new space, like old furniture; this will lighten your load significantly. Organized Packing Strategy Once you’ve decluttered, it’s time to pack. Start with your least-used items first, as this will set a pace for the entire process and allow you to tackle the move methodically: Pack seasonal items and decorations first, then move on to kitchenware and infrequently used appliances. Label each box with its contents and the room it belongs to. This labeling will save you time during unpacking and help you find essentials. Addressing Challenges and Stressors Even with a solid plan, stress can arise on moving day. Here are some ways to mitigate common moving day challenges: Develop a moving day timeline that outlines when each task should be completed. Make arrangements for pets and children ahead of time to keep them safe and occupied, reducing stress for both them and you. Plan for meals and snacks throughout the day to maintain energy levels. Future Trends in Moving Looking ahead, emerging technologies might change the landscape of the moving process: Smart home tech can simplify managing space and ensuring your new home is efficiently configured for your needs. Apps that help coordinate moving tasks, monitor inventory, and assist with logistics are becoming more popular, enabling smoother transitions. Why Enhanced Bot Security Matters for North County San Diego Homebuyers

Update Understanding the Rise of Bot Attacks in Real Estate In our increasingly digital world, the problem of bot attacks is no longer confined to just large corporations; it has now come knocking at the door of real estate professionals. According to recent data from Jim the Realtor, his blog is experiencing a staggering 30,000 to 40,000 bot visits per day. This influx of bots probing the digital landscape for valuable market insights marks a significant shift in how real estate websites are impacted by automated traffic. The technology behind websites like Cloudflare is helping to mitigate these attacks, but understanding the underlying motives of such intrusions is vital. Deciphering Bot Scores: What Do They Mean? A bot score ranges from 1 to 99, where a score of 1 signals that a request likely originates from a bot, while a score of 99 indicates a genuine human interaction. Reports show that about 40% of Jim's blog traffic is classified as 'Likely Human'. This insight paints a clearer picture of the audience and highlights the genuine interest and engagement that real insights into the home buying and selling process can generate.
